Winter weather conditions play a significant role in the operation of the surface transportation system. When water freezes on the road surface or blowing snow obscures visibility, motorist safety may be compromised. Moreover, the presence of snow or ice on the roadway can reduce travel speeds until appropriate winter maintenance activities are undertaken. These effects are often thought of in causative ways: for example, an increase in bad winter weather conditions will result in an increase in crashes and an increase in winter maintenance costs. If these causative relationships could be quantified, this could have far-reaching impacts, including facilitating proactive approaches to winter roadway safety, assessing the cost- effectiveness of various winter maintenance resources, evaluating the effectiveness of safety projects while taking into account the impacts of unusal weather, and others.
